Frederick the Great battled Ivan the Terrible following Alexander the Great and preceding Catherine the Great in Alexander the Great vs Ivan the Terrible. He was portrayed by EpicLLOYD.

Information on the rapper

Frederick II, better known as Frederick the Great (German: Friedrich der Große), was born on January 24th, 1712, in Berlin, Prussia. He was King of Prussia from 1740 until 1786. His most significant accomplishments during his reign included his military victories, his reorganization of Prussian armies, his patronage of the Arts and the Enlightenment in Prussia, and his final success against great odds in the Seven Years' War. He died at the age of 74 on August 17th, 1786, in Potsdam, Prussia.

Trivia

  • Frederick is the eleventh rapper to die in-battle.
    • He is the second one to die peacefully, after Steve Jobs.
  • He is the second rapper to step in later during the battle yet have their own title card, after Macho Man Randy Savage.
  • He is the first rapper with a title card to not be introduced by the announcer.
  • He is the only rapper in his battle who did not speak his own language, in this case, German.
  • He was good friends with (and possibly a lover to) French philosopher Voltaire, who previously appeared in Eastern Philosophers vs Western Philosophers.
  • The stance in which he stands during his title card, with his left foot on his right leg, mimics Jethro Tull frontman and flautist Ian Anderson.
